The Logitech G PRO X Superlight 2 is the mouse used by countless esports professionals, and after testing it extensively, I understand why. At just 60g, this mouse practically floats across your mousepad. The HERO 2 sensor with 44,000 DPI is the most precise sensor I’ve ever tested, with flawless tracking at any sensitivity.

The 8kHz polling rate is a game-changer for competitive gaming. While most gaming mice operate at 1000Hz (1ms), the Superlight 2’s 8kHz (0.125ms) provides significantly faster input response. In fast-paced FPS games where milliseconds matter, this can give you a genuine competitive edge.

How to Choose the Best Gaming Mouse During Big Spring Sale

With so many deals available, it’s important to know what to look for when choosing a gaming mouse. The right choice depends on your hand size, grip style, preferred games, and budget. Here are the key factors to consider.

DPI and Sensor Quality

DPI (dots per inch) determines mouse sensitivity, but raw DPI numbers aren’t as important as sensor quality. A high-quality sensor with lower DPI will outperform a cheap sensor with high DPI. Look for optical sensors from reputable manufacturers like Logitech’s HERO series or Razer’s Focus+ sensors.

Most gamers use DPI settings between 400 and 1600, regardless of the mouse’s maximum capability. The important thing is consistent tracking without acceleration or prediction. All the mice in this roundup feature quality sensors that deliver accurate 1:1 tracking.

Wireless vs Wired

Wireless gaming mice have come a long way, with modern technologies like LIGHTSPEED and HyperSpeed delivering virtually zero latency. If you value freedom of movement and a clean desk setup, wireless is worth considering. Just be prepared for battery management or the additional cost of charging systems.

Wired mice remain the choice of many competitive players due to their absolute reliability and zero battery concerns. They’re also typically more affordable. The best wired mice perform identically to wireless models in real-world use.

Ergonomics and Grip Style

Your grip style (palm, claw, or fingertip) and hand size are the most important factors in choosing a mouse shape. What feels comfortable to one person might cause fatigue for another. If possible, try mice before buying or pay attention to return policies.

Palm grippers typically prefer larger mice with pronounced humps, claw grippers often favor medium-sized mice with flatter profiles, and fingertip grippers usually like smaller, lightweight mice. All the mice in this list specify which grip styles they work best for.

Battery Life

For wireless mice, battery life ranges from around 60 hours to over 250 hours depending on the model and features. Consider how often you’re willing to recharge or replace batteries. Some premium mice like the G502 Lightspeed offer wireless charging compatibility for continuous use.

Wired mice obviously don’t have battery concerns, which is one reason many competitive players prefer them. You never have to worry about your mouse dying in the middle of an important match.

Build Quality and Durability

Gaming mice take a lot of abuse, especially during intense gaming sessions. Look for mice with quality switches rated for millions of clicks. Optical switches are becoming more popular because they eliminate double-click issues that can plague mechanical switches.

The mouse feet (skates) are also important for smooth gliding. Premium PTFE feet provide better glide than standard plastic feet. Some enthusiasts upgrade to third-party feet for even better performance.
